What are the benefits of using an all-in-one scanner compared to standalone scanners?

When it comes to scanners, there are many different options available, from standalone scanners to all-in-one scanners. But which one is the best for you? All-in-one scanners are becoming increasingly popular for their convenience and ease of use. An all-in-one scanner is a device that combines the functionality of a scanner, copier and printer into one single machine. This makes it a great choice for those who need to scan documents, photos, or even 3D objects quickly and easily.

The benefits of using an all-in-one scanner compared to standalone scanners are numerous. Not only do all-in-one scanners save space, but they also provide users with the ability to scan, copy, and print in one fell swoop. This eliminates the need for multiple devices, reducing clutter in the home or office. Furthermore, all-in-one scanners can also save users time and money, as they handle multiple tasks in a single device.

These devices are also more cost-effective than standalone scanners, as they can save users money by eliminating the need for purchasing separate scanners, printers, and copiers. Additionally, all-in-one scanners are often more efficient than standalone scanners, as they can scan multiple documents or photos at once. This greatly reduces the time spent scanning documents or photos, allowing users to accomplish more in less time.

Overall, all-in-one scanners provide a great solution for those looking for a convenient and cost-effective way to scan documents, photos, or 3D objects. For those who need to scan documents quickly and easily, an all-in-one scanner is the perfect choice.

Cost-Effectiveness

The use of an all-in-one scanner is cost-effective compared to using multiple standalone scanners. An all-in-one scanner combines the features of multiple scanners into a single package, and can therefore save a business or organization money on equipment costs, installation costs, and maintenance costs. Additionally, many all-in-one scanners are capable of scanning a variety of document sizes and types, saving time since one scanner is able to do the work of multiple scanners. Furthermore, many all-in-one scanners are more energy-efficient than standalone scanners, saving money on electricity costs.

The cost-effectiveness of all-in-one scanners compared to standalone scanners is especially beneficial for businesses or organizations with limited budgets. All-in-one scanners can help to reduce costs, as businesses or organizations can purchase one device that is capable of performing the functions of multiple standalone scanners. This not only reduces upfront costs, but also helps to reduce maintenance costs over time, as all-in-one scanners require less maintenance than multiple standalone scanners.

The benefits of using an all-in-one scanner compared to standalone scanners also extend to time savings. As all-in-one scanners are capable of scanning a variety of document sizes and types, they can save businesses or organizations time by eliminating the need to switch out scanners for different document types. Additionally, many all-in-one scanners are equipped with advanced features, such as automatic document feeders and duplex scanning, which helps to save time and improve workflow.

Overall, the use of an all-in-one scanner is cost-effective compared to the use of multiple standalone scanners. All-in-one scanners reduce upfront costs, maintenance costs, and electricity costs, and help to save time and improve workflow. This makes all-in-one scanners an ideal solution for businesses and organizations with limited budgets.
